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Milano Centrale Station, Italy and Nyon, Switzerland?

Trenitalia EuroCity operates a train from Milano Centrale to Lausanne every 4 hours. Tickets cost CHF 60–110 and the journey takes 3h 38m. Alternatively, Luxair, ITA Airways, and five other airlines fly from Milan Linate Airport (LIN) to Geneva International Airport (GVA) every 4 hours.
